Hunting & Shooting

The sport of sporting clays

Hunting and the shooting sports have been a long-standing tradition at Palmetto Bluff for years (if not centuries). The Palmetto Bluff Shooting Club features 13 sporting clays stations winding through an expansive 40-acre hardwood bottom. An elevated and covered five-stand station, plus a wobble deck field, makes a total of 14 shooting sites.

Racquet Sports

Racquet sports of all types

Our immaculately kept lawns are good for more than just a barefoot stroll. You’ll be happy to know we keep two pristine croquet lawns on the property at Wilson Lawn and Racquet Club — our recreational hub and perfect gathering place for friendly competition. Along with the lawns, the expansive club facility includes eight Har-Tru tennis courts, six pickleball courts, two bocce courts, four courtside shelters and a well-equipped pro shop and pavilion.

The May River’s favorite course.

You might chalk it up to mere curiosity if you wind up in a bunker at the May River Golf Course. After all, it’s not every day that you get to walk through sand from Ohio — especially when you’re golfing in the South Carolina Lowcountry. But like everything at this beautiful Jack Nicklaus Signature Course, the sand was chosen for a reason, as its angular grain adheres better to sloped surfaces and holds up to coastal weather. Of course, there’s much more than sand on this beautiful par-72 course, which weaves almost 7,200 yards along the banks of the May River.
